Mobile-optimized Websites

In today's digital landscape, ensuring a seamless browsing experience on smartphones is crucial for retaining visitors. Mobile-friendly sites are designed to adapt to various screen sizes and functionalities, enhancing user engagement and reducing bounce rates. As mobile traffic continues to grow, businesses must prioritize responsive design strategies to stay competitive.
Key Considerations for Mobile Optimization:
- Responsive design that adjusts to different screen resolutions
- Fast loading speeds to prevent user frustration
- Intuitive navigation for easy access to content
- Touch-friendly elements and buttons
Mobile Optimization Benefits:
Mobile-optimized websites lead to higher user satisfaction, increased conversions, and better search engine rankings.
For example, here are some essential elements to consider when designing a mobile-optimized website:
- Use of flexible grids and layouts
- Fast and efficient image compression techniques
- Elimination of unnecessary pop-ups and heavy scripts
Comparison of Desktop vs. Mobile Optimization:
Aspect | Desktop | Mobile |
---|---|---|
Screen Size | Large | Small |
Navigation | Mouse & keyboard | Touchscreen |
Page Load Time | Less critical | Crucial for user retention |
Mobile-Optimized Websites
With the increasing use of smartphones, mobile optimization has become an essential element of web development. Mobile-optimized websites are specifically designed to provide an enhanced user experience on mobile devices, ensuring that content is easy to navigate, read, and interact with. This approach prioritizes faster loading times, responsive layouts, and touch-friendly interfaces.
Modern mobile optimization techniques involve adjusting content, layout, and functionality to suit smaller screens. Unlike desktop sites, which often have complex navigation and larger visuals, mobile-optimized websites are simplified for quick access, making them essential for improving user retention and engagement on mobile platforms.
Key Features of Mobile-Optimized Websites
- Responsive Design: Ensures that the website adjusts seamlessly to various screen sizes and orientations.
- Improved Loading Speed: Faster loading times are critical, as users are less likely to wait for a slow page to load on mobile.
- Touch-Friendly Navigation: Buttons, menus, and other elements are designed for easy interaction with touchscreens.
Benefits of Mobile Optimization
"Mobile optimization directly influences user engagement and conversion rates. A well-optimized website leads to higher user satisfaction and better retention."
- Increased User Engagement: Mobile-optimized websites improve user experience, leading to longer browsing sessions and higher interaction rates.
- Better SEO Ranking: Google rewards mobile-friendly sites with higher search rankings, making optimization vital for visibility.
- Higher Conversion Rates: Streamlined design and faster loading times lead to more successful transactions and reduced bounce rates.
Common Mobile Optimization Techniques
Technique | Description |
---|---|
Responsive Web Design | Adapts the layout based on the device’s screen size, ensuring an optimal view across all devices. |
Image Compression | Reduces image sizes to improve page load speeds without compromising visual quality. |
Mobile-First Approach | Designing websites with mobile users in mind before adapting them for desktop use. |
How Mobile-Optimized Websites Enhance User Experience on Small Screens
As mobile device usage continues to rise, it is crucial for websites to deliver a seamless browsing experience on smaller screens. Mobile-optimized websites are specifically designed to improve usability, making navigation and interaction more intuitive on smartphones and tablets. By adapting to various screen sizes and resolutions, these websites ensure that users don’t encounter frustrating issues such as unreadable text, slow load times, or awkward navigation.
Optimizing a website for mobile devices ensures that users have an efficient, enjoyable browsing experience, even on the go. This approach focuses on creating a responsive layout that adjusts based on the user's screen size, offering smooth, accessible interactions without sacrificing design or functionality.
Key Features of Mobile Optimization
- Responsive Design: Websites automatically adjust to the size of the screen, ensuring content is easily viewable without excessive zooming or scrolling.
- Fast Load Times: Mobile-friendly websites are typically optimized for faster loading, improving user retention and satisfaction.
- Touchscreen Compatibility: Buttons, menus, and other interactive elements are sized and spaced for easy tapping and swiping.
"A mobile-optimized website doesn't just scale content; it transforms the browsing experience, ensuring all users can navigate effortlessly across devices."
Benefits of Mobile Optimization
- Improved Navigation: Mobile-optimized sites use simplified menus and layouts that make it easy to find key information quickly.
- Increased Engagement: By providing a user-friendly experience, users are more likely to stay on the site longer, explore more content, and return in the future.
- Better Conversion Rates: Mobile-optimized websites are easier to interact with, which often leads to higher conversion rates for tasks such as form submissions or purchases.
Comparison of User Experience
Standard Website | Mobile-Optimized Website |
---|---|
Text may be too small to read on small screens. | Text scales appropriately for easy readability. |
Navigation requires zooming or horizontal scrolling. | Menus are streamlined and navigation is optimized for touch. |
Long load times due to unoptimized images and scripts. | Optimized media and faster loading times for a smoother experience. |
Key Design Principles for Mobile-Friendly Website Layouts
When designing mobile-optimized websites, the layout plays a crucial role in ensuring a smooth user experience. The small screen size of mobile devices requires that content be organized in a way that is easy to read and navigate without zooming or scrolling excessively. This calls for prioritizing key information and streamlining navigation, which is why understanding the core principles behind effective mobile layout design is essential.
Mobile-first design emphasizes simplicity, accessibility, and responsiveness. By considering how users interact with their mobile devices, designers can create layouts that load quickly and provide intuitive navigation, regardless of screen size. Below are the key design principles for creating mobile-friendly website layouts.
Essential Design Elements for Mobile Layouts
- Responsive Design: The layout should automatically adjust to different screen sizes and orientations, ensuring a consistent experience across all devices.
- Minimalism: Focus on the essential content and remove any unnecessary elements. This reduces clutter and enhances user navigation.
- Touch-friendly Navigation: Ensure that buttons, links, and interactive elements are large enough for users to tap easily, without accidental clicks.
Optimizing Layout for User Experience
Ensure that your mobile layout loads quickly by optimizing images, minimizing HTTP requests, and using techniques like lazy loading for non-essential elements.
- Prioritize content based on user needs. For example, place most important information at the top of the page to avoid excessive scrolling.
- Utilize single-column layouts for easy reading and navigation, making it easier for users to interact with the site.
- Test the layout across multiple devices to identify and fix any issues with the responsiveness or functionality.
Comparing Mobile and Desktop Layouts
Design Element | Mobile | Desktop |
---|---|---|
Navigation | Hamburger menu or bottom bar for easy access | Horizontal menu or sidebar with visible options |
Content Layout | Single column, vertically scrollable | Multiple columns, horizontal scrolling |
Font Size | Larger text for readability on small screens | Smaller text with more content visible |
How Mobile Optimization Affects SEO Rankings on Google
In recent years, Google has placed increasing importance on mobile optimization for websites, recognizing that more users access content from mobile devices than ever before. As a result, Google’s search ranking algorithms prioritize mobile-friendly sites, influencing how they are ranked in search results. Websites that are optimized for mobile offer better usability, faster load times, and a seamless browsing experience, all of which are factors that affect SEO performance.
One of the key components that Google considers when ranking websites is how well they perform on mobile devices. Google uses mobile-first indexing, meaning that the mobile version of a site is crawled and indexed first. This shift in focus from desktop to mobile has led to a significant impact on SEO rankings, making it essential for webmasters to prioritize mobile optimization.
Key Factors Influencing Mobile Optimization for SEO
- Page Load Speed: Faster loading times on mobile devices are critical for both user experience and SEO rankings. Mobile users are less patient with slow-loading pages, which can result in higher bounce rates and lower rankings.
- Responsive Design: A responsive design ensures that the website adjusts to different screen sizes, providing a consistent user experience across all devices. This is favored by Google over separate mobile sites.
- Mobile-Friendly Content: Content that is easily readable on smaller screens, without the need for zooming, is essential. Google evaluates how well content adapts to mobile devices when determining SEO rankings.
“Google’s mobile-first indexing means that your site’s mobile version is now considered the primary version for ranking purposes.”
How Mobile Optimization Impacts Search Rankings
- Improved User Experience: Sites that load quickly and provide an intuitive mobile interface see increased user engagement, which positively influences search rankings.
- Lower Bounce Rates: A mobile-optimized website is more likely to keep users engaged, reducing bounce rates. Lower bounce rates signal to Google that the site provides valuable content and a positive user experience.
- Increased Visibility: Mobile-optimized sites are more likely to appear higher in search results on mobile devices, as Google prioritizes mobile-friendly pages for mobile users.
Impact of Mobile Optimization on Different Types of Websites
Type of Website | Effect of Mobile Optimization on SEO |
---|---|
E-commerce | Mobile optimization helps retain customers and drives higher conversion rates, leading to better SEO rankings. |
News Websites | Mobile-friendly designs increase engagement, leading to higher rankings for frequently updated content. |
Blogs | Improved readability and fast load times on mobile devices lead to longer time on site and better SEO performance. |
Speed Optimization Tips for Mobile Websites to Reduce Load Time
Optimizing the speed of a mobile website is crucial for ensuring a smooth user experience. Mobile users typically expect quick page load times, and slow websites can lead to higher bounce rates and lower engagement. Here are some practical steps you can take to improve your mobile site's performance.
Implementing proper speed optimization techniques not only helps reduce the loading time but also contributes to better search engine rankings. Google, for example, takes mobile page speed into account when ranking websites. Below are some effective tips to boost load times on mobile devices.
1. Compress and Optimize Images
Large, unoptimized images can significantly slow down page load times. Use the following methods to compress and optimize images for mobile devices:
- Use modern image formats like WebP for better compression.
- Resize images to fit the dimensions they will be displayed at.
- Implement lazy loading to load images only when they are visible to the user.
Optimizing images can reduce the total page size, leading to faster load times and a smoother mobile experience.
2. Minimize HTTP Requests
Each element on a web page (CSS, JavaScript, images) requires a separate HTTP request, which can increase load times. To reduce these requests:
- Combine CSS and JavaScript files into single files.
- Use image sprites to merge multiple images into one.
- Reduce the number of external scripts and resources, such as third-party widgets.
3. Enable Browser Caching
By enabling caching, you can store frequently accessed files locally on the user's device, which prevents the need to reload them every time the user visits your site.
- Set expiry dates for static resources like images and scripts.
- Use versioning for files to ensure users always get the latest version when needed.
4. Use a Content Delivery Network (CDN)
A CDN stores copies of your site on multiple servers located worldwide. By serving content from a server closer to the user's location, you can significantly reduce load times.
Using a CDN can help minimize latency and speed up content delivery to users, especially those located far from your primary server.
5. Optimize Critical Rendering Path
Prioritize the loading of essential elements (such as above-the-fold content) to ensure the page renders quickly. Use the following practices:
- Defer the loading of non-essential JavaScript.
- Inline critical CSS and defer the rest.
- Use asynchronous loading for JavaScript files.
Action | Benefit |
---|---|
Defer non-essential JS | Faster rendering of critical content |
Inline critical CSS | Improved page load time |
Common Pitfalls in Mobile Website Design and How to Avoid Them
Designing a mobile-friendly website requires attention to user experience across various devices, but several common mistakes can undermine its effectiveness. One of the main issues is failing to optimize content for smaller screens, which can lead to slow load times or users needing to zoom in excessively. To avoid these pitfalls, it’s crucial to test your site on multiple devices and ensure that content is easily accessible without the need for unnecessary scrolling or resizing.
Another common mistake is not considering touch-based navigation properly. Mobile users rely on touch gestures, so button sizes and interactive elements must be optimized for tapping, rather than clicking. Proper spacing between links and buttons can significantly improve the user experience and reduce accidental taps.
1. Overcrowded Layout
An overcrowded design can overwhelm users, making it hard to navigate and find key information. To maintain a clean and organized layout, use clear visual hierarchy and give enough space for important elements.
- Keep content concise and focused on essential information.
- Avoid excessive text and complex navigation menus.
- Use whitespace strategically to create a breathable design.
2. Slow Loading Speed
Mobile users expect fast load times. Large images, videos, and poorly optimized code can delay page rendering. Optimize media, reduce the size of files, and utilize caching to speed up the experience.
“Mobile sites should load in 3 seconds or less. Anything longer risks losing users.”
3. Ignoring Touchscreen Usability
Designing a website for desktop use does not always translate to a seamless mobile experience. Buttons that are too small, crowded menus, or links that are difficult to click are common problems.
- Ensure clickable elements are at least 44px by 44px.
- Ensure no overlapping text or images that could hinder touch accuracy.
- Test across multiple devices to validate touchscreen interactions.
4. Poor Typography
Text that is too small or hard to read on mobile devices can frustrate users and make content inaccessible. Choose legible fonts and consider font sizes that scale with the device size.
Mobile Screen Size | Recommended Font Size |
---|---|
Small | 16px |
Medium | 18px |
Large | 20px |
The Role of Adaptive Layout in Crafting Mobile-Friendly Websites
Adaptive layouts play a crucial role in ensuring that websites provide a seamless experience across various mobile devices. By implementing responsive design techniques, web developers can make sure that their websites automatically adjust to different screen sizes and orientations. This adaptability is essential as mobile traffic continues to grow, and user expectations for smooth, intuitive interfaces rise. Without responsive design, websites may appear distorted or difficult to navigate on smaller screens, leading to a poor user experience and potentially high bounce rates.
Responsive design employs flexible grids, images, and CSS media queries to optimize a website's layout based on the characteristics of the device. This approach eliminates the need for separate mobile versions of a website, providing a single, consistent user experience regardless of the device used. Furthermore, it allows for faster loading times and less maintenance, as changes to the main site automatically reflect on all devices.
Key Components of Responsive Design
- Flexible Grids: A grid system that resizes proportionally to fit the screen, ensuring content adjusts dynamically.
- Fluid Images: Images that scale within their containing elements, preventing distortion or overflow on different screen sizes.
- CSS Media Queries: Rules that apply different styling depending on the device’s characteristics, such as screen width, resolution, or orientation.
"Responsive design is not just about resizing content; it’s about enhancing user experience by tailoring the interface to each individual device."
Advantages of Adaptive Layouts for Mobile-Optimized Websites
- Improved User Experience: Responsive design ensures users have a consistent and optimal experience regardless of the device.
- Faster Loading Times: By eliminating unnecessary redirects to separate mobile sites, responsive websites tend to load faster.
- Cost Efficiency: Maintaining one site rather than multiple versions reduces costs and effort for ongoing updates and management.
Device Type | Layout Adaptation |
---|---|
Smartphones | Content stacked vertically, touch-friendly navigation elements |
Tablets | Two-column layout with larger images and adjusted text sizes |
Desktops | Wide layout with sidebars and optimized high-resolution visuals |
How to Evaluate and Monitor the Performance of Your Mobile Website
Testing and measuring the performance of your mobile website is critical to ensure a smooth user experience. With mobile traffic increasing rapidly, it's essential to optimize your site for various devices and screen sizes. This process involves assessing load times, responsiveness, and usability on mobile platforms. Regular testing helps identify areas for improvement and ensures that your site remains efficient across a wide range of mobile devices.
Effective performance testing can be done using a variety of tools and strategies. By leveraging these tools, you can monitor critical aspects such as speed, interactivity, and overall performance under different network conditions. This data provides valuable insights into how well your mobile website is functioning and where optimizations are needed.
Key Steps to Measure Mobile Website Performance
- Check Mobile Speed: Use tools like Google PageSpeed Insights or Lighthouse to measure the load time of your site. Aim for a load time of under 3 seconds.
- Test Responsiveness: Ensure that your site adapts well to different screen sizes. Tools like BrowserStack or Responsive Design Checker can help with this.
- Monitor Interactivity: Use metrics like First Interactive and Time to Interactive (TTI) to evaluate how quickly users can engage with your content after loading.
- Network Conditions: Test your site under varying network speeds (3G, 4G, Wi-Fi) to ensure that performance remains optimal across all conditions.
Tools for Mobile Website Performance Testing
- Google PageSpeed Insights: Provides performance reports and suggests optimizations.
- WebPageTest: Offers detailed insights into load times, first contentful paint, and visual progression.
- Lighthouse: Audits your site for performance, accessibility, SEO, and more, providing actionable recommendations.
- GTmetrix: Combines insights from Google PageSpeed and YSlow, offering detailed analysis of website performance.
Important Metrics to Track
Keep in mind that mobile users expect fast, seamless interactions. Optimizing for the right metrics will result in better user retention and satisfaction.
Metric | Ideal Value | Tools to Measure |
---|---|---|
Load Time | Under 3 seconds | Google PageSpeed Insights, GTmetrix |
Time to Interactive (TTI) | Under 5 seconds | Lighthouse, WebPageTest |
First Contentful Paint | Under 1 second | Lighthouse, WebPageTest |
Choosing the Right Platform and Tools for Mobile Optimization
When selecting the best platform for mobile optimization, it's crucial to consider various factors that directly impact performance, speed, and user experience on mobile devices. The platform you choose should support responsive design, ensure quick load times, and be compatible with popular content management systems (CMS). With the increasing number of mobile internet users, picking the right tools and platforms can significantly improve your website's accessibility and performance.
Another important consideration is the compatibility with various mobile devices and operating systems. Platforms like WordPress, Shopify, and Squarespace offer built-in mobile optimization features, while others might require additional plugins or custom code. It’s important to assess the scalability and flexibility of the platform as your website grows or your needs change over time.
Platform and Tools to Consider
- WordPress: Offers many themes and plugins optimized for mobile devices.
- Shopify: Great for e-commerce with mobile-friendly templates and features.
- Wix: Easy-to-use builder with responsive mobile design options.
- Squarespace: Known for its visually appealing mobile-optimized templates.
When it comes to mobile optimization tools, there are various options that can enhance your site’s responsiveness:
- Google PageSpeed Insights: Measures the performance of your website on mobile and desktop devices.
- BrowserStack: Allows you to test your website on different mobile devices and browsers.
- AMP (Accelerated Mobile Pages): A framework to speed up page load times on mobile devices.
- Responsive Design Tester: Helps you visualize how your website will appear on different mobile screens.
"A mobile-optimized website doesn’t just look good; it functions well and provides a seamless experience for users on any device."
Comparison of Key Platforms for Mobile Optimization
Platform | Mobile-Friendly Features | Ease of Use |
---|---|---|
WordPress | Responsive themes, plugins for mobile optimization | Moderate |
Shopify | Mobile-optimized themes, fast loading | Easy |
Squarespace | Mobile-optimized templates, built-in mobile editing tools | Easy |
Wix | Responsive design, mobile-specific editing features | Easy |